** The carpet cleaning market for Estelline, Texas, is characterized by a reliance on regional service providers. As a very small rural community, it does not support a dedicated local carpet cleaning business. Consequently, residents and commercial properties depend on established companies from larger nearby hubs such as Childress, Amarillo, and Lubbock. These providers typically service Estelline as part of a broader regional route, which may involve travel fees. The competition, while not local, is of high quality, featuring both national franchises (Stanley Steemer, Chem-Dry) and reputable local restoration companies (All-Brite). These companies bring professional-grade equipment, certifications (like IICRC), and insurance, ensuring a professional standard of service. Typical pricing for a standard residential carpet cleaning in this region ranges from $150 to $300 for an average-sized home, though prices can be higher for large homes, severe staining, or add-on services like tile and grout or upholstery cleaning. It is standard practice for these companies to provide free, upfront quotes over the phone or in person.

In the Estelline area, most professional services charge by the square foot, with average prices ranging from $0.25 to $0.50 per square foot. The final cost depends on the carpet's condition, the cleaning method (e.g., hot water extraction), and any necessary pre-treatments for stubborn Texas red clay or agricultural soils common in our region. Always request an in-home estimate for the most accurate quote.

In Texas, it is generally prohibited to discharge carpet cleaning wastewater into storm drains or septic systems without proper permitting due to contaminants and chemicals. Reputable Estelline-area cleaners will follow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) guidelines, typically collecting and disposing of wastewater at approved facilities to protect our local groundwater and land.
